A team from Baku State University (BSU) won first place among 16 higher education institutions in the “create a green world! – 2” digital solutions hackathon, organized jointly by the State Agency for Public Service and Social Innovations under the President of the Republic of Azerbaijan through its “Green ASAN” environmental programme and the International Dialogue for Environmental Action (IDEA) Public Union.
The BSU team members – third-year students of the Faculty of Applied Mathematics and Cybernetics Tahir Aliyev and Jamil Jafarli, second-year student of the Faculty of Chemistry Aytaj Sadiqova, and fourth-year student of the Faculty of Ecology and Soil Science Nijat Hasanov – presented an innovative mobile platform project called “Grove,” designed to encourage daily environmentally friendly behavior.
The application developed by the team provides users with daily eco-tasks, verifies their completion through photo submissions, and motivates users through a points and rewards system. The key advantage of the “Grove” project lies not only in raising awareness but also in offering an interactive ecosystem that actively engages individuals in real environmental actions. Users can report polluted areas on a map, participate in problem-solving, connect with other users, and compete through a leaderboard.
